Description

Nursery stock supporting device
Technical Field
The application relates to the field of nursery stock maintenance, especially, relate to a nursery stock supporting device.
Background
With the increasing importance of ecological protection in China and the vigorous development of various tree planting actions, the green plant coverage rate in China is gradually improved, and the air quality is obviously improved.
In the process of planting the saplings, the planted nursery stocks need to be supported, so that the survival rate of the nursery stocks is improved. When supporting the nursery stock among the prior art, often adopt the form that utilizes the bracing piece to carry out simple support to nursery stock circumference face to protect the nursery stock.
Aiming at the related technologies, the inventor considers that the protection of the nursery stock is poor by simply adopting the support rod to support the nursery stock.

Detailed Description
The present application is described in further detail below with reference to figures 1-8.
The embodiment of the application discloses nursery stock supporting device. Referring to fig. 1, a nursery stock supporting device includes supporting component 1, and supporting component 1 includes first protection plate 11, and first protection plate 11 is provided with two and first protection plate 11 sets up symmetrically to the nursery stock, has improved the protectiveness to the nursery stock.
Referring to fig. 2, the abutting positions of the two first supporting plates 11 are both fixedly provided with a first fixing plate 111, the first fixing plate 111 is provided with a first fixing bolt 3 and a first fixing nut 31, the first fixing bolt 3 passes through the first fixing plate 111, and the first fixing nut 31 is in threaded connection with the first fixing bolt 3. First fixed plate 111, first fixing bolt 3 and first fixation nut 31 mutually support, fix two first protecting boards 11, reduce two first protecting boards 11 and take place to drop.
With reference to fig. 1 and 2, the supporting assembly 1 further includes a second supporting plate 12, the second supporting plate 12 is provided with two second supporting plates 12, the two second supporting plates 12 are arranged symmetrically to the nursery stock, and the second supporting plates 12 are inserted into the first supporting plate 11 and connected with the first supporting plate 11 in a sliding manner. The second supporting plate 12 improves the supporting area of the supporting component 1 to the nursery stock, and the second supporting component 1 can be adjusted according to the actual height of the nursery stock, so that the protection area and the protection effect of the nursery stock are improved. The abutting positions of the two second supporting plates 12 are fixedly provided with a second fixing plate 121, the second fixing plate 121 is provided with a second fixing bolt 4 and a second fixing nut 41, the second fixing bolt 4 penetrates through the second fixing plate 121 and is in threaded connection with the second fixing plate 121, and the second fixing nut 41 is in threaded connection with the second fixing bolt 4.
With reference to fig. 3, 4 and 5, the second support plate 12 is provided with a pad protection assembly 6, the pad protection assembly 6 includes a pad protection plate 61 and a screw 62, the pad protection plate 61 is disposed between the nursery stock and the second support plate 12, the rotary screw 62 passes through the second support plate 12 and is in threaded connection with the second support plate 12, and the rotary screw 62 is rotatably connected with the pad protection plate 61. One side of the cushion protection plate 61 close to the nursery stock is arc-shaped, and one side of the cushion protection plate 61 close to the nursery stock is fixedly provided with a rubber pad. The cushion protection plate 61 plays a supporting role for the nursery stock, the protection performance of the nursery stock is further improved, the rubber cushion is soft, the friction between the cushion protection plate 61 and the side face of the nursery stock is reduced, and a certain protection effect is achieved for the nursery stock. In addition, the lead screw 62 can be rotated according to the diameter of the nursery stock, the distance between the cushion protection plate 61 and the second support plate 12 can be adjusted, the rubber layer 611 of the cushion protection plate 61 is abutted to the circumferential surface of the nursery stock, and the use convenience of the cushion protection assembly 6 is improved.
Referring to fig. 6, the bottom of the second support plate 12 is fixedly provided with a sliding block 122, the top of the first support plate 11 is fixedly provided with a clamping block 113, and a sliding groove 112 is formed in the first support plate 11 corresponding to the sliding block 122. When the second supporting plate 12 moves up to the sliding block 122 and abuts against the clamping block 113, the clamping block 113 blocks the movement of the second supporting plate 12, and the probability that the second supporting plate 12 falls off from the first supporting plate 11 is reduced, so that the use convenience of the second supporting plate 12 is improved.
With reference to fig. 1, 7 and 8, a supporting component 2 is disposed on a side surface of the supporting component 1, the supporting component 2 includes a supporting mechanism 21 and a limiting plate 22, and the supporting component 2 is disposed in a plurality and the supporting component 2 is disposed around the first supporting plate 11 at equal intervals. The supporting mechanism 21 includes a supporting rod 211 and a supporting sleeve 212, the supporting sleeve 212 is rotatably connected to the limiting plate 22, and the supporting sleeve 212 is disposed obliquely upward along a direction close to the seedling. The support rod 211 is rotatably connected with the side surface of the second support plate 12, the support rod 211 is inserted in the support sleeve 212, and the support rod 211 is slidably connected with the support sleeve 212. The side of the supporting sleeve 212 is opened with an adjusting hole 2121, and the adjusting hole 2121 is opened with a plurality of adjusting holes 2121 arranged along the extending direction of the supporting sleeve 212. An adjusting bolt 5 is inserted into the adjusting hole 2121, and one end of the adjusting bolt 5 passing through the adjusting hole 2121 is connected with an adjusting nut 51 through a thread. When the height of the second support plate 12 is adjusted, the relative position between the support rod 211 and the support sleeve 212 can be adjusted at the same time, so that the length of the support assembly 2 can be adjusted, and the convenience of the support assembly 2 can be improved. The upper surface of the limiting plate 22 is provided with the anchor bolt 221, so that the support component 2 is conveniently fixed, and the stability of the support component 2 is improved.
The implementation principle of a nursery stock supporting device of the embodiment of the application is as follows: when the nursery stock needs to be supported, the first support plate 11 and the second support plate 12 are arranged on two sides of the nursery stock, the first fixing bolt 3 is inserted into the first fixing plate 111 and fixed by the first fixing nut 31, and the second fixing bolt 4 is inserted into the second fixing plate 121 and fixed by the second fixing nut 41. And then the height of the second support protection plate 12 and the distance of the cushion protection plate 61 are adjusted according to the length and the diameter of the nursery stock, so that the protection effect on the nursery stock is achieved. And then, adjusting the length of the supporting mechanism 21, and fixing the limiting plate 22 by using the anchor bolt 221 to finish the protection of the nursery stock.
